Embodiment 1
[0031] Such as Figure 1-4 As shown, the high-pressure flexible PE steel wire composite pipe quick-connect joint processing method is used for the type dn160*3.5MPaPE steel wire composite pipe, including the following steps:
[0032] a), the high-pressure flexible PE steel wire composite pipe is placed on the third roller mechanism 7, and the high-pressure flexible PE steel wire composite pipe is purged through the high-pressure nozzle 1 on the end of the pipe to ensure that the end of the pipe is clean and free of impurities and dirt;
[0033] b) After the end of the pipe is purged, one end of the high-pressure flexible PE steel wire composite pipe is consigned by the third roller mechanism 7 to the heating zone of the first pipe oven 2 for heating, and the first pipe oven 2 is heated by an electric heating coil , at the same time, in order to ensure the uniformity of the pipe, the pipe is rotated at a uniform speed by the third idler mechanism 7 during heating;
